Publisher Description: This text contains a comprehensive treatise on plywood and veneer, including detailed descriptions and explanations on their uses, suitability, and advantages. This detailed guide contains all the information one could possible want to know on the subject, and will be of much value to the woodworker. Complete with helpful illustrations and handy tips, this guide makes for a great addition to collections of woodworking literature and is not to be missed. The chapters of this book include: 'Historic Uses of Veneer', 'Plywood Defined', and 'Advantages of Plywood Explained'.
